Tips for Buying Medical Practices In San Mateo County, CA

Understand Local Market Dynamics

Before making any purchasing decisions, it’s crucial to research the healthcare landscape in San Mateo County. This area has a diverse patient population and a competitive environment among private practices, clinics, and hospital-affiliated providers. Analyze insurance participation, referral networks, and demographic shifts that could impact patient volume. Understanding the region’s specific regulatory requirements and knowing how local reimbursement rates compare to statewide averages will help you gauge the practice’s potential and set realistic expectations for growth.

Conduct Thorough Due Diligence

When evaluating a medical practice for sale, perform exhaustive due diligence. Examine up-to-date financial statements, accounts receivable aging reports, payer mix, and provider productivity reports to assess the practice’s financial health and operational efficiency. Investigate legal standing, credentialing status, and compliance with California’s healthcare regulations, including HIPAA and staffing requirements. It’s also wise to review existing contracts with managed care organizations or Medicare/Medicaid, as these can significantly affect revenue stability and transferability.

Focus on Transition Planning and Retention

Successfully acquiring a medical practice in San Mateo County depends not just on the transaction itself, but on what happens afterward. Develop a robust transition plan that includes staff retention, clear communication with patients, and strategies for minimizing disruption to care. Building rapport with employees and the outgoing provider is key to maintaining goodwill and ensuring continuity of care for patients. Retaining staff can help preserve institutional knowledge and strengthen your reputation in the community, making for a smoother post-acquisition integration.
